About Hans Rameau

Hans Rameau (1901–1980) was a German screenwriter. Having established himself in the German film industry he left the country following the Nazi Party's taking of power in 1933. He spent time in several other countries, including Austria and Britain before moving to Hollywood. He returned to Europe in 1951. From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
